Автор: Филип Рик (Filip Hric) Оригинал статьи Перевод: Ольга Алифанова
Вы узнаете:
Как создать кастомную команду, автоматически дополняющую ваши селекторы
Как выполнить проверку тестов, написанных на TypeScript
Как грепнуть селекторы из приложения
Как создать предупреждение, если в приложении есть неиспользуемые селекторы.
Cypress советует использовать селекторы data-cy в качестве лучшей практики для выбора элементов на странице. Недавно мы отлично подискутировали в дискорде, действительно ли эта практика хороша. Лично я сильно склоняюсь к "да". Если вы в моем лагере, у меня есть для вас ряд полезных советов.
INXY Subscription Tracker — это бесплатный инструмент, который поможет Вам освободить время, сэкономить бюджет и избежать стресса. Он автоматически находит и отслеживает все Ваши личные или деловые подписки. Это также обеспечивает более широкий контекст для принятия разумных решений об использовании и эффективности подписок. По сути, это единая SaaS, позволяющая держать в порядке все остальные SaaS, подписки и повторяющиеся услуги.
Находите и отслеживайте свои подписки
- INXY автоматически обнаруживает все подписки, совершенные любым способом оплаты и поддерживает их в актуальном состоянии.
- Позволяет посматривать все подписки на панели инструментов с указанием затрат, предстоящих платежей и другой соответствующей информации.
- Отправляет уведомления в обычном мессенджере или календаре о важных событиях, связанных с подпиской (предстоящие платежи, даты истечения срока действия карты и т. д.).
СКОРО:
- Виртуальная карта INXY, которая позволит покупать, приостанавливать или отменять подписки.
- Возможность оплачивать любые услуги в любой валюте, включая криптовалюту.
Принимайте разумные решения и добивайтесь максимальной эффективности (СКОРО)
- Персонализированная лента новостей показывает специальные предложения и условия в зависимости от Ваших предпочтений.
- Используйте обширный каталог подписок для сравнения и поиска услуг.
- Рекомендации Smart AI подчеркивают потенциал оптимизации использования подписки.
- Получайте регулярные отчеты с аналитическими данными для планирования бюджета подписки.
- Обнаружение дубликатов, неиспользуемых или избыточных подписок.
- Установите лимиты расходов для каждого продавца, чтобы автоматически блокировать скрытые платежи и двойные платежи за повторяющиеся расходы.
Сотрудничество (СКОРО)
- Совместное использование позволяет оплачивать услуги и пользоваться ими вместе с коллегами, семьей и друзьями.
- Синхронизируйте подписки Ваших сотрудников с Microsoft Team и G Suite.
- Синхронизируйте счета с подписками с помощью бухгалтерского программного обеспечения (Xero, QuickBooks).
- Назначайте разные роли (пользователь, владелец подписки, администратор), чтобы контролировать использование ваших подписок.
- Всегда знайте, кто в Вашей команде отвечает за подписку.
- Отслеживайте свои текущие расходы точно по проекту/команде/сотруднику.
- Получайте отзывы с примечаниями и отзывами от команды об использованных подписках, чтобы избежать дублирования или неэффективных решений.
Присоединяйтесь к нашему сообществу в любой социальной сети, чтобы получать актуальную информацию о разработке продуктов, новости рынка подписок, финансовые советы и многое другое. Мы ценим Ваши отзывы и каждый комментарий, так как они помогают нам улучшить наш инструмент отслеживания подписок и высвободить ваше время, деньги и усилия.
В этом материале будет кратко рассказано, почему Shift-Left – это не всегда хорошо и почему не стоит забывать о традиционной модели тестирования. Рассмотрим паттерны поведения QA при тестировании обычных задач и как постепенно стать продуктивным тестировщиком, не утопая в регрессах и бесконечных проверках одного и того же.
Я часто подхожу к тестированию как к игре в шахматы. Это делает процесс поиска проблем не монотонным, порой даже увлекательным и полезным. В научной и технической литературе у этого метода тестирования есть название: Shift-Left тестирование, но всегда ли нужен такой подход?